4 Ways to Get Buzz-Building Brand Advocates

A brand advocate isn’t just a satisfied customer, it’s a satisfied customer who is talking about your products or services, or your business itself, in such a way that prospective customers turn into actual customers as a result of buzz and word of mouth marketing.
